What skills and experience we're looking for
We are seeking to appoint a Finance Officer to start on 04/11/24. You will have the responsibility of leading the school’s finances. Therefore, you will be responsible for the day to day running of the budget e.g. processing all orders.You will also be responsible for the month end process and the budget setting and amending.You will produce written reports for governors. You will process staffing details for their pay. The job description suggests that you will have experience in these matters, however, there is training available so this is not necessarily needed.
You will also manage the staff in the office, undertake significant office duties and be responsible for health and safety and building management and maintenance. Office experience is highly preferred. NVQ is not necessarily needed. This is a very important role with highly significant responsibilities.
